This post may contain affiliate links. Please read our disclosure policy.

Table of Contents
If you’re on the hunt for the perfect appetizer that combines creamy, cheesy goodness with crispy, savory bacon, look no further. This Warm Bacon Cheddar Dip is a game-changer, destined to become the star of your next gathering. Whether you’re hosting a cozy family get-together or a lively party with friends, this dip is guaranteed to impress. With its tantalizing blend of flavors and easy preparation, it’s the ultimate choice for any occasion.
Let’s face it, finding the perfect appetizer can be a daunting task. You want something that’s not only delicious but also easy to prepare and sure to please a crowd. That’s where this Warm Bacon Cheddar Dip comes into play. Imagine a dish where creamy cream cheese meets the irresistible crunch of bacon, topped with gooey, melted cheese, and finished off with a zesty salsa kick. It’s a flavor explosion that will have your guests coming back for seconds.
Not only does this dip deliver on taste, but it also offers convenience. With minimal prep and cook time, you can focus on enjoying the party instead of being stuck in the kitchen. Plus, it’s versatile enough to accommodate a variety of dietary preferences and can be easily customized to suit your taste.
So why should you make this Warm Bacon Cheddar Dip? Because it’s a surefire way to elevate any event with a mouthwatering, cheesy, bacon-filled delight that’s easy to make and even easier to devour.
Ingredients
Here’s what you’ll need to create this show-stopping dip:
- 8 ounces Cream Cheese (Room Temperature)
- 1 teaspoon Chili Powder
- 1/2 teaspoon Salt
- 1/2 teaspoon Black Pepper
- 1 cup Salsa
- 1 Tomato (diced)
- 1/4 cup Black Olives (sliced)
- 6 slices Bacon
- 1 cup Mexican Style Cheese Blend
- Green Onions (for garnish)
Step-by-Step Guide
1. Preheat Your Oven
Set your oven to 350°F (175°C). This is the perfect temperature to get your dip hot and bubbly without overcooking it.
2. Cook the Bacon
In a large skillet, cook the bacon slices over medium heat until crispy. This usually takes about 5-7 minutes. Once crispy, transfer the bacon to a paper towel-lined plate to drain and cool. Once cooled, chop into small pieces. This will add a delightful crunch to your dip.
3. Prepare the Cream Cheese Mixture
In a large bowl, beat together the cream cheese, chili powder, salt, pepper, and salsa until the mixture is smooth and well combined. The cream cheese should be at room temperature to ensure it mixes easily and thoroughly.
4. Assemble the Dip
Spread the cream cheese mixture evenly into an ungreased 9-inch cast iron or oven-safe dish. This will be the base layer of your dip.
5. Add Toppings
Sprinkle the diced tomatoes, sliced black olives, shredded cheese, and chopped bacon over the cream cheese mixture. Make sure to distribute the toppings evenly to ensure every bite is full of flavor.
6. Bake the Dip
Place the dish in the preheated oven and bake for 10-15 minutes. You’re looking for the cheese to be melted and bubbly. Keep an eye on it to prevent overbaking.
7. Garnish and Serve
Remove the dish from the oven and garnish with chopped green onions. Serve warm with your favorite tortilla chips and watch your guests rave about this delectable dip.
Expert Tips and Tricks
- Room Temperature Cream Cheese: Make sure your cream cheese is at room temperature before mixing. This will help it blend smoothly with the other ingredients.
- Crispy Bacon: For the crispiest bacon, avoid overcrowding the skillet and cook over medium heat to ensure even crisping.
- Customize Your Salsa: Use your favorite salsa or even a homemade version for a personal touch.
- Cheese Varieties: While Mexican cheese blend works great, you can experiment with other cheeses like sharp cheddar or Monterey Jack for different flavor profiles.
- Avoid Overmixing: When mixing the cream cheese base, avoid overmixing to keep the dip creamy and smooth.
- Use Fresh Ingredients: Freshly diced tomatoes and freshly sliced olives will enhance the flavor and texture of your dip.
- Adjust Spice Levels: If you prefer a spicier dip, consider adding a pinch of cayenne pepper or using a hot salsa.
Variations to Try
- Buffalo Chicken Bacon Dip: Add shredded cooked chicken and buffalo sauce for a spicy twist.
- BBQ Bacon Dip: Swap out salsa for barbecue sauce for a smoky flavor.
- Veggie Lover’s Dip: Incorporate finely chopped bell peppers and onions for added crunch.
- Spicy Jalapeño Dip: Add diced jalapeños for an extra kick.
- Cheesy Bacon Ranch Dip: Mix in a packet of ranch seasoning for a ranch flavor.
- Mediterranean Style: Replace salsa with tzatziki and add some crumbled feta.
- Southwest Style: Add black beans and corn to give it a southwestern flair.
- Greek Yogurt Dip: Use Greek yogurt instead of cream cheese for a tangy flavor.
- Creamy Avocado Dip: Mix in some mashed avocado for a creamy, guacamole twist.
- Mushroom Bacon Dip: Sauté some mushrooms and add them to the dip for an earthy flavor.
- Pesto Bacon Dip: Incorporate a few tablespoons of pesto for an Italian twist.
- Caramelized Onion Dip: Add caramelized onions for a sweet and savory flavor.
- Sweet and Spicy Dip: Blend in some honey and sriracha for a sweet and spicy combo.
- Ranch and Cheddar: Mix in ranch seasoning and extra cheddar cheese for more flavor.
- Loaded Baked Potato Dip: Add chopped green onions, sour cream, and extra cheese to mimic a loaded baked potato.
What to Serve It With
- Tortilla Chips: The classic choice for dipping.
- Crackers: Try different varieties like whole grain or multi-seed.
- Pita Chips: For a slightly different texture and flavor.
- Sliced Baguette: Toasted for added crunch.
- Vegetable Sticks: Carrot and celery sticks add a healthy option.
- Pretzels: For a salty and crunchy alternative.
- Breadsticks: Soft and perfect for scooping.
- Flatbread: Cut into pieces for dipping.
- Bagel Chips: A crispy and flavorful choice.
- Cheese Crisps: For an extra cheesy experience.
- Sweet Potato Chips: A slightly sweet and crunchy option.
- Corn Chips: Adds a classic crunch.
- Mini Naan: Warm and perfect for dipping.
- Tortilla Roll-Ups: Slice into pieces for an easy bite-sized option.
- Stuffed Breadsticks: Filled with cheese or herbs for added flavor.
Storage Tips
- Refrigeration: Store any leftover Warm Bacon Cheddar Dip in an airtight container in the refrigerator. It will keep for up to 3 days.
- Freezing: While not ideal for freezing, you can freeze the dip for up to a month. To reheat, thaw in the refrigerator overnight and bake until heated through.
- Reheating: To reheat, place the dip in an oven-safe dish and warm it in a preheated oven at 350°F (175°C) for about 10-15 minutes. Stir occasionally for even heating.
How Much to Make for Family Gatherings
For a family gathering or party, plan on making 1 cup of Warm Bacon Cheddar Dip per 4 people. This allows for generous portions and seconds if desired. For larger gatherings, simply multiply the recipe as needed, and consider using multiple dishes to ensure everyone gets a taste.
Advance Preparation
You can prepare the Warm Bacon Cheddar Dip up to 24 hours in advance. Assemble the dip in your baking dish, cover it with plastic wrap or foil, and refrigerate until you’re ready to bake. When you’re ready to serve, remove the cover and bake as directed.